On the land stabilise banks of river, creeks and streams by planting vegetation. control soil erosion by replanting areas of disturbed soil. set up barriers to prevent sediment from building sites washing into stormwater drains. reduce agricultural nutrient run-off ? reduce use of pesticides, herbicides and fertilisers.

The purpose of this water system is to reduce the chances of flooding problems occurring in the civil drain, including local lakes and creeks. OSDs typically have two functions. The first is to collect and temporarily store excess stormwater. The second is to slowly release water into the town stormwater system.

However, stormwater design and ?green infrastructure? capture and reuse stormwater to maintain or restore natural hydrologies. Detaining stormwater and removing pollutants is the primary purpose of stormwater management.

Stormwater management facility means a facility or other technique used to reduce volume, flow rate, or pollutants from stormwater runoff. Stormwater facilities may reuse, collect, convey, detain, retain, or provide a discharge point for stormwater runoff.

The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) and states implement a federally mandated program for controlling stormwater discharges from industrial facilities and municipalities.

A stormwater system is a tool for managing the runoff from rainfall. Before Florida was developed, the state was an area with many wetlands.

Stormwater Management is the process of controlling the stormwater runoff that comes primarily from impervious surfaces like parking lots, driveways, and rooftops. Rural areas are typically comprised of pervious areas, such as farmland, pastures, and woodlands.

The ultimate goal of stormwater management is to maintain the health of streams, lakes and aquatic life as well as provide opportunities for human uses of water by mitigating the effects of urban development.
